diff --git a/src/main.jsx b/src/main.jsx index 7a3310c..51170af 100644 --- a/src/main.jsx +++ b/src/main.jsx @@ -45,6 +45,8 @@ import { isNotEmpty } from '@/utils/commons' import ProductsManage from '@/views/products/Manage'; import ProductsDetail from '@/views/products/Detail'; import ProductsAudit from '@/views/products/Audit'; +import PickYear from './views/products/PickYear' + import { PERM_ACCOUNT_MANAGEMENT, PERM_ROLE_NEW, PERM_OVERSEA,PERM_TRAIN_TICKET, PERM_AIR_TICKET, PERM_PRODUCTS_MANAGEMENT, PERM_PRODUCTS_OFFER_PUT } from '@/config' import './i18n' @@ -94,6 +96,7 @@ const initRouter = async () => { { path: "products/:travel_agency_id/:use_year/:audit_state/edit",element:}, { path: "products/audit",element:}, { path: "products/edit",element:}, + { path: "products/pick-year",element: }, // ] }, diff --git a/src/views/products/PickYear.jsx b/src/views/products/PickYear.jsx new file mode 100644 index 0000000..6329175 --- /dev/null +++ b/src/views/products/PickYear.jsx @@ -0,0 +1,40 @@ +import { useNavigate } from "react-router-dom"; +import { Row, DatePicker, Flex, Col, Typography } from "antd"; +import dayjs from "dayjs"; +import { usingStorage } from "@/hooks/usingStorage"; + +function PickYear() { + const navigate = useNavigate(); + const { travelAgencyId } = usingStorage(); + + return ( + <> + + + + + 请选择采购年份 + + { + const useYear = date.year(); + navigate(`/products/${travelAgencyId}/${useYear}/all/edit`); + }} + /> + + + + + ); +} +export default PickYear;